The rota

This is a full-time position, offering 40 hours per week. The working hours are as follows: two days per week 8:30 AM - 6:45 PM, three days per week 8:30 AM - 4:00 PM, and one Saturday in three 8:30 AM - 12:30 PM. There are no out-of-hours or bank holiday shifts.
